Meaning of bubbles
- A thin film of liquid inflated with air or gas; as, a soap bubble; bubbles on the surface of a river.
- A small quantity of air or gas within a liquid body; as, bubbles rising in champagne or aerated waters.
- A globule of air, or globular vacuum, in a transparent solid; as, bubbles in window glass, or in a lens.
- A small, hollow, floating bead or globe, formerly used for testing the strength of spirits.
- The globule of air in the spirit tube of a level.
- Anything that wants firmness or solidity; that which is more specious than real; a false show; a cheat or fraud; a delusive scheme; an empty project; a dishonest speculation; as, the South Sea bubble.
- A person deceived by an empty project; a gull.
- To rise in bubbles, as liquids when boiling or agitated; to contain bubbles.
- To run with a gurgling noise, as if forming bubbles; as, a bubbling stream.
- To sing with a gurgling or warbling sound.
